Robbins Umeda LLP Is Investigating Graham Packaging Company Inc. Acquisition for Shareholders

Robbins Umeda LLP, a shareholder rights litigation firm, is interested in helping shareholders of Graham Packaging Company Inc. (NYSE: GRM).  The firm has commenced an investigation into possible breaches of fiduciary duty and other violations of state law by members of the board of directors of Graham Packaging in connection with their efforts to be acquired by Silgan Holdings Inc. (NASDAQ: SLGN).

On April 13, 2011, Silgan Holdings announced they have entered into a definitive agreement under which it will acquire Graham Packaging for approximately $4.1 billion.  Under the current agreement, Graham Packaging shareholders will receive 0.402 shares of Silgan common stock and $4.75 in cash for each share of Graham Packaging common stock they hold.  Based on Silgan's closing stock price on April 12, 2011, the transaction implies a value of $19.56 per Graham Packaging share.  The transaction is expected to close late in the third quarter of 2011.

The investigation is focused on whether Graham Packaging's board is undertaking a fair process to obtain maximum value for its shareholders.  Three analysts have set price targets higher than the offer price, ranging from $20 to $22 per share.  Moreover, on February 10, 2011, Graham Packaging reported fourth quarter 2010 financial results that beat analyst estimates.  Of particular interest, each of Silgan's Co-Chairmen of the Board, R. Philip Silver and D. Greg Horrigan, who collectively beneficially own 29% of Silgan's common stock, have entered into an agreement to vote in favor of the transaction.  In addition, Blackstone Capital Partners III L.P. and certain of its affiliates and the Graham Family, who collectively own on a fully diluted basis 65% of Graham Packaging's common shares, have entered into agreements to vote in favor of the transaction.
